So, what exactly is business finance? Simply put, it's about making smart decisions about money within a business. It involves everything from raising money (like getting a loan or selling stock) to investing money (like buying equipment or expanding the business) and managing the money that comes in and out. It's about planning, controlling, and making the most of a company's financial resources. The goal is always to maximize the value of the business. Time Value of Money (TVM)
First up, we have the Time Value of Money (TVM). This is a super important idea! The basic principle is that a dollar today is worth more than a dollar tomorrow. Why? Because you can invest that dollar today and earn interest or returns, making it grow over time. Understanding TVM is essential for making sound financial decisions. Financial Statements
Now, let's move on to Financial Statements. These are the key documents that tell you about a company's financial health. The main ones are the income statement (also called the profit and loss statement), the balance sheet, and the cash flow statement. They provide a snapshot of a company's performance and financial position. We will cover the different components of each statement and how to interpret them. Capital Budgeting
Next up is Capital Budgeting. This is the process of deciding which long-term investments a company should make. This could be anything from buying new equipment to expanding into a new market. Understanding how to evaluate different investment options is essential for long-term financial success. This is a crucial area of business finance. We'll cover the tools and techniques used to make these decisions, such as net present value (NPV) and internal rate of return (IRR). Working Capital Management
Finally, we have Working Capital Management. This is about managing a company's day-to-day finances, like how much cash to keep on hand, how to manage inventory, and how to handle accounts receivable (money owed to the company). It's all about ensuring the company has enough resources to operate smoothly. We will delve into the strategies that companies use to optimize their working capital.
